Amazon Pushes The Envelope With Elastic MapReduce

Not too long back, trying to do something as time consuming Hadoop on a smaller scale bordered on impossible, to at the very least, not worthwhile for many smaller research firms. Now that Amazon has released Elastic MapReduce for the masses, it is believed that this new service is going to do wonders for empowering those on tighter budgets to work with processing tremendous amounts of data without the overhead needed previously.

What many people might not realize is that some researchers were already using Hadoop on Amazon’s EC2. What has changed now is the fact that easy to use tools are now in place for EC2 users that will making elastic computing with Hadoop much easier and obtainable with less work.

Working with tremendous amounts of data up until now was something of a challenge. But with these new tools from Amazon at the disposal of the world’s researchers, I see a lot of good things coming down the line here in future.
